Transaction 08e91c59158cf7df5f5f60a70321698106ab4fc1fe810dbfffcfffac6a95613b
1 Input
2 Outputs
- 08e91c59158cf7df5f5f60a70321698106ab4fc1fe810dbfffcfffac6a95613b:0
- 08e91c59158cf7df5f5f60a70321698106ab4fc1fe810dbfffcfffac6a95613b:1
value 130140
address 3DTnZsGv4dZJGRe1hiqeuxq9TxHV2JcDUg
value 678955910
address 1DsuZTYL7tUcRFSHvr8ZQTUxzVQXy1Cuv4